Triple Lock Under Threat
from Galway News Today | 2 Min News | The Daily News Now!
Galway TD Mairéad Farrell is sounding the alarm over the government’s plan to scrap the Triple Lock—a safeguard requiring Dáil, government, and UN approval before Irish troops deploy overseas. She warns this move undermines Ireland’s neutrality, sovereignty, and democratic will, arguing the public overwhelmingly supports keeping the Triple Lock and that removing it without a referendum risks sending troops into missions against national values. Minister Helen McEntee is reportedly pushing for cabinet approval to dismantle the policy, sparking fierce debate over Ireland’s role on the global stage and whether this change weakens its long-standing commitment to neutrality.
